Re: trans serial # location (LT1driver)
Most frequently, it is stamped on the right rear of the maincase, near the stamped date code (which begins with a P). I have been building/repairing Muncies for about 35yrs and I have seen VINs stamped in numerous locations, including on the top, front of the case.

Re: trans serial # location (LT1driver)
1967 and earlier corvettes with muncie 4-speeds had the V.I.N. stamped on the driverside rear vertical flange of the maincase (to the rear of the side cover). The V.I.N. moved to the passenger side in the 1968 model year when that flange was increased in width from 1/2" to 1". Hope this helps--Crash

Re: trans serial # location (LT1driver)
Went out to my warehouse with 100+ muncie cores transmissions and 200+ main cases and found 5 good examples of 1967 and earlier corvette V.I.N. stamps all on the driverside 1967--P7E26--7S120782--010 maincase
1966--P0212--6S114922--010 maincase
1965--P1214---S105492--325 maincase
1964--P1021---4108000--325 maincase
1963--P0709---3119558--704 maincase
Hope this helps--Crash

Re: trans serial # location (crash-ent.)
Yup, VIN derivative stamp on mid-year Corvettes is on the driver's side - I was fixated on the Muncie "P"-code, not the VIN; 1st-Gen Camaros all had the VIN derivative on the pass. side, so did the St. Louis passenger car plant and almost all other GM assembly plants. Don't know why St. Louis-Corvette put it on the driver's side - Engineering direction was to put it adjacent to the Muncie code, but Corvette ignored it. :rolleyes:
